Only one admiral in history achieved a perfect combat record -- 43 battles fought, zero ships lost, not a single defeat. This is the story of Fyodor Ushakov, the Russian commander who revolutionized naval warfare decades before Nelson, then retired to a monastery and became an Orthodox saint.

From the Black Sea to the Mediterranean, Ushakov's aggressive tactics and spiritual discipline created victories that seemed impossible. While Western navies clung to rigid line formations, he pioneered concentrated firepower and rapid maneuvering—innovations that his enemies could neither comprehend nor counter.
